Youngblood Auto Group gives away a new car for 95% or better attendance
Youngblood Auto Group made the pay-off for attending school a little bit better for Charles Marlin, Parkview. Charles was handed the keys to a new 2019 Kia Soul, on Wednesday May 15, 2019 when his name was drawn as the winner of the Youngblood Attendance Car Giveaway.
Students in grades 9-12 with 95 percent attendance or above were entered into a preliminary drawing at their respective high school. Students who have 95-99 percent attendance were eligible to enter once and those who have perfect attendance were eligible to enter twice. Each high school randomly selected five semi-finalists.
The 25 semi-finalists, representing each high school, were entered into a final drawing, held at Youngblood Nissan Chrysler Kia, 3410 S. Campbell (corner of Walnut Lawn and Campbell). This is the 20th anniversary of the car giveaway.
In addition to the car giveaway, Youngblood Auto Group also provided cash prizes listed below.
